Description

Sonifex REDBOX RB-DHD6 Digital 6-Way Stereo Headphone Distribution Amplifier.

The RB-HD6 headphone distribution amplifier is a 1U rack-mount which distributes stereo audio to up to 6 different sets of headphones, or can be used as 6 independent headphone amplifiers, each with their own input and volume control. A typical application might be to provide common headphone feeds for guests in a radio studio, with a separately derived feed, perhaps including talk-back, for the presenter.

The main stereo input is on XLR-3 connectors on the rear panel which are electronically balanced and can be wired unbalanced. A stereo/mono input select switch on the rear panel sums left and right outputs to provide a mono feed to the headphones. The unit can receive an override audio signal via a jack socket for each output channel. Plugging in the jack plug will divert the headphone output from the master audio signal to the audio present on the jack plug.

The override audio inputs can also be individually configured as parallel outputs of the front sockets, by setting internal jumpers. The master volume control adjusts overall level of the 6 outputs and does not affect the level of channels using the override inputs. The master volume can be disabled by internal jumpers.

Sonifex is a Private Limited Company owned by the Directors, which manufactures broadcast audio equipment for the radio, TV, security and telecommunications industries. This is a family business, started as a partnership in 1969 by Paul and Dorothy Brooke, which has had a steady turnover of trading, and has established a recognised position in the radio broadcasting industry. The company became a limited company in 1983 and the operation moved to new purpose built premises at Irthlingborough, Northamptonshire, during 1986. In 1987, the size of the premises was doubled to 11,000 square feet of production space with excellent working conditions and facilities for recreation. An extension was completed in February 1998, adding another 7,000 ft² of engineering and storage space. Over 90% of British radio broadcast studios have in the past used some form of Sonifex equipment and the company exports on average 50% of its products. Sonifex supplies equipment to over 60 countries world-wide and is recognised for the quality and reliability of its designs and finished equipment.
